PHP - Philippine Peso
Country: Philippines
Region: Asia
Sub-Unit: 1 ₱ = 100 centavos
Symbol: ₱
The Philippine peso derived from the Spanish silver coin Real de a Ocho or Spanish dollar, in wide circulation in the Americas and South-East Asia during the 17th and 18th centuries. The Philippine peso was introduced on May 1, 1852.
PHP Exchange Rates USD - US Dollar
Country: United States of America
Region: North America
Sub-Unit: 1 Dollar = 100 cents
Symbol: US$
The U.S. dollar is the currency most used in international transactions. Several countries use the U.S. dollar as their official currency, and many others allow it to be used in a de facto capacity. It's known locally as a buck or greenback.
